A palaeoreconstruction of the Isernia-La Pineta (Molise, S-Italy) late Middle Pleistocene site, very famous as the most ancient European palaeolithic site (ca 600 kys BP): Stephanorhinus hundsheimensis Toula is present here together with some other peculiar members of the Isernia-La Pineta fauna: four hominids, Homo heidelbergensis archaic form (two of them are dealing with their prey, the big cervid Praemegaceros solilhacus), four elephants (Palaeoloxodon antiquus), some bisons (Bison schoetensacki) by the Italian expert Gianfranco Mensi.
